Compensation Analyst

LHH is seeking a Senior Compensation Analyst with 3–5 years of experience to support and execute key compensation programs for the organization. This role focuses on the programmatic operations of the compensation function, balancing competitive pay practices with talent attraction needs.

Responsibilities

Support and execute core compensation programs across the organization
Assist with annual focal review process and incentive payout cycles
Conduct market pricing and participate in salary survey submissions
Respond to general compensation-related inquiries from internal stakeholders
Ensure accuracy, consistency, and timeliness across recurring compensation processes
Collaborate with HR and Compensation teams to ensure smooth execution of programs
Maintain organization, attention to detail, and process efficiency

Required

3–5 years of experience in compensation or related HR functions
Strong understanding of compensation fundamentals and program administration
Detail-oriented, organized, and able to manage recurring processes with accuracy
Effective communication skills for interacting with internal teams
